About us

About us

Local policing teams are groups of officers dedicated to serving the community. Teams are made up of officers based in the area, supported by additional officers from the wider area. 

Teams work closely with local authorities, organisations, partners and residents to decide policing priorities. This helps teams find long-term solutions to local problems.

Policing priorities

  • Priority:

    Action taken:

  • Priority:

    Anti social Behaviour - This is a priority for the next three months based on resident feedback, crime data and ongoing local concerns.

    Issued 30 June 2026

    Action taken:

    We will:
    - Deal robustly with people committing ASB, making use of available legislation to divert offenders and prevent harm.
    - Ensure officers are visible in areas of heightened concern.
    - Conduct further neighbourhood surveys to identify areas of concern.

    Actioned 30 September 2026

  • Priority:

    Rural Crime - based on resident feedback, crime data and ongoing local concerns

    Issued 30 June 2026

    Action taken:

    We will:
    - Carry out high intensity targeted patrols focusing on vulnerable locations and properties.
    - Visit local farms and offer preventative advice with specialist departments
    - Offer farmers and rural residents Smartwater

    Actioned 30 September 2026

  • Priority:

    Theft: This is a priority for the next three months based on resident feedback, crime data and ongoing local concerns.

    Issued 30 June 2026

    Action taken:

    We will:
    - Conduct high visibility foot patrols in problematic areas.
    - Deal robustly with people committing offenses using policing powers.
    - Provide crime prevention advice to victims and local neighbourhoods being targeted by offenders
    - conduct further neighbourhood priority surveys to identify areas of concern.

    Actioned 30 September 2026
